Plan of Video Activity Book 1
Unit 1
First day at class  A young man starts class at a university and gets a surprise. Functional Focus Introducing oneself; addressing people (titles)

Grammar Present tense of be  Vocabulary Nationalities

Unit 2
I need a change!  A woman dreams about a new career. Functional Focus Talking about work

Grammar Wh-questions with do; prepositions: at, in, and to Vocabulary Occupations

Documentary 1 Jobs  People talk about what they do as we watch them at work.
Unit 3
At a garage sale  A couple has different opinions about things at a garage sale.
Functional Focus Buying and selling things; expressing opinions 

Grammar How much and how old  Vocabulary Garage sale items

Unit 4
What kind of movies do you like?  Three friends try to agree on what they should do one evening.
Functional Focus  Expressing likes and dislikes; making plans 

Grammar Object pronouns   Vocabulary Kinds of movies

Documentary 2 What’s your favorite kind of music?  People talk about their preferences in music as they watch live performances.
Unit 5
A family picnic  A young man invites a friend to a picnic. Functional Focus Talking about family 

Grammar Present continuous vs. simple present  Vocabulary Family members

Unit 6
I like to stay in shape.  A man tries to impress a jogger by telling her about his fitness routine.
Functional Focus Talking about routines 

Grammar Adverbs of frequency  Vocabulary Sports and exercise

Unit 7
How was your trip to San Francisco?  On their way to work, a woman tells a friend about her trip. Functional Focus Describing past events; expressing opinions 

Grammar Past tense  Vocabulary Places in San Francisco

Unit 8
Are you sure it’s all right?  A man invites two friends to a party and finds out that he has made a mistake. Functional Focus Describing locations; inviting 

Grammar Prepositions of location  Vocabulary Places in the neighborhood

Documentary 3 In a suburban home  A woman talks about her home as she walks through each room.
Unit 9
Help is coming.  A couple is relaxing at home when they are surprised by visitors.
Functional Focus Describing physical appearance

Grammar Modifiers with participles and prepositions Vocabulary Terms for physical appearances

Unit 10
Sorry I’m late.  A man has a problem on his way to meet a friend.
Functional Focus Telling a story 

Grammar Present perfect; connecting words: first, after that, next, then, and finally

Vocabulary Past tense of verbs in the video

Unit 11
Across the Golden Gate Bridge  A couple gets directions and advice as they rent a car at the airport.
Functional Focus Asking and telling about places; giving advice

Grammar Should and shouldn’t Vocabulary Terms to describe an area

Unit 12
Feeling bad  A man receives various remedies for his cold from his co-workers. Functional Focus Giving advice; talking about health problems

Grammar Modal verbs may and could for requests; suggestions Vocabulary Cold remedies

Documentary 4 At the Mall of America  People talk about the largest mall in North America as they look and shop.
Unit 13
At the state fair  Various people enjoy a day at the fair. Functional Focus Ordering food 

Grammar Would and will Vocabulary Things at a state fair

Unit 14
Around the World: the game show Three contestants test their knowledge of geography and try to win a prize. Functional Focus Asking and answering questions about geography

Grammar Comparisons with adjectives Vocabulary Geographical terms

Unit 15
May I speak to Cathy?  Cathy’s father is trying to work, but the phone keeps ringing.
Functional Focus Making a telephone call; receiving messages

Grammar Requests with tell and ask  Vocabulary Telephone expressions

Unit 16
A whole new Marty  Marty changes his image and makes a new friend.
Functional Focus Exchanging personal information

Grammar Describing changes with the present tense, past tense, and present perfect 

Vocabulary Verb and noun pairs to describe changes

Documentary 5 What is American food?  People try to figure out what American food really is.
